What Types of Fatal Accidents Can Lead to Wrongful Death Claims?

A wrongful death claim alleges that a fatal accident would not have happened but for the negligence, recklessness, or intentional misconduct of a defendant.

Some examples of accidents that can result in wrongful death include (but are not limited to):

  • Defective Products: When a loved one dies due to a defective or dangerous product, surviving family members may have grounds to file a wrongful death lawsuit against the manufacturer, distributor, or retailer. Defective product cases can involve faulty auto parts, unsafe electronics, toxic household items, or poorly designed medical devices. In the Brownsville area, fatal product failures often result from companies cutting corners on safety testing or ignoring known defects. These tragedies are preventable, and holding companies accountable through a product liability wrongful death claim can bring justice and prevent future harm.
  • Car, Truck, Motorcycle, and Bicycle Accidents: Fatal motor vehicle accidents are among the leading causes of wrongful death in Brownsville, Harlingen, San Benito, and nearby communities. Whether it’s a deadly car crash, 18-wheeler truck accident, motorcycle collision, or bicycle fatality, these cases often involve negligent drivers, drunk driving, or distracted driving. Families who lose loved ones in traffic accidents may be entitled to compensation for funeral costs, lost financial support, and emotional suffering. A skilled wrongful death attorney can help you investigate the crash, determine liability, and fight for the justice your family deserves.
  • Dog Bites and Fatal Animal Attacks: In some cases, dog attacks can lead to fatal injuries, especially in children or elderly victims. Wrongful death claims involving dog bites in Brownsville may arise when an aggressive dog is left unrestrained or when an owner fails to prevent a known dangerous animal from harming others. Texas law allows families to hold dog owners legally responsible when their negligence leads to a fatal attack. If your loved one was killed in a dog bite incident, you may be entitled to pursue compensation for your loss.
  • Cribs, Beds, and Infant Products: Tragically, defective cribs, beds, and infant sleep products can lead to fatal injuries such as suffocation, entrapment, or strangulation. Parents in Brownsville who have lost a child due to unsafe children’s products may have a wrongful death case against the product manufacturer or distributor. These heartbreaking cases demand immediate legal action, not just for justice, but also to raise awareness and help prevent future tragedies.
  • Heavy Machinery Accidents: Heavy machinery, when improperly operated or poorly maintained, can cause fatal accidents in construction, manufacturing, and industrial settings. These include deaths caused by crane collapses, forklift accidents, or malfunctioning equipment. In South Texas, including Brownsville, surviving families of those killed in heavy machinery accidents may pursue wrongful death lawsuits against employers, contractors, or equipment manufacturers, depending on the cause of the incident.
  • Workplace Accidents: Workplace fatalities can happen in any industry, especially in high-risk sectors like construction, agriculture, and transportation. From slip-and-fall incidents to equipment-related deaths, these tragedies often occur because of negligent safety practices, inadequate training, or OSHA violations. If your loved one died on the job in Brownsville or a nearby city, you may be able to file a wrongful death claim against a third party—such as a contractor, subcontractor, or manufacturer—who played a role in the accident.
  • Oil Rig Accidents: Oil field and offshore rig accidents are unfortunately common in Texas and often result in catastrophic or fatal injuries. Explosions, falls, and equipment malfunctions on oil rigs can be deadly. When oil companies prioritize profit over safety, workers pay the price. If your family lost someone in an oil rig fatality near Brownsville, our legal team can investigate the cause of the accident and help you file a wrongful death lawsuit to recover damages and hold the responsible party accountable.
  • Construction Accidents: Construction is one of the most dangerous industries, and construction site fatalities are sadly all too frequent. Common causes of death include falls from heights, scaffolding collapses, electrocution, and being struck by heavy equipment. Families who lose a loved one in a construction-related fatality in Brownsville, Los Fresnos, or Port Isabel may be able to pursue a wrongful death claim against negligent contractors, subcontractors, property owners, or manufacturers of faulty equipment.
  • Boating Accidents: In the coastal and Gulf-facing regions near Brownsville and South Padre Island, boating accidents can turn deadly due to reckless operation, alcohol use, or lack of proper safety equipment. Whether it’s a collision, capsizing, or drowning, when a loved one dies in a fatal boating incident, surviving family members have the right to seek justice through a wrongful death lawsuit. Holding negligent boaters or tour companies accountable is key to protecting others from similar dangers.
  • Pedestrian Accidents: Pedestrians are incredibly vulnerable to traffic accidents, and fatal pedestrian incidents are on the rise in Brownsville and across Cameron County. These tragedies often occur when drivers fail to yield, speed through intersections, or drive distracted. If a loved one was struck and killed by a vehicle while walking, your family may have grounds for a wrongful death claim. Pedestrian fatalities are preventable, and legal action helps bring closure while raising awareness of pedestrian safety.

Who Can File a “Wrongful Death” Lawsuit in Texas?

Only certain individuals are allowed to bring a wrongful death lawsuit in Texas and can include:

  • The surviving spouse;
  • The surviving child (including adopted children);
  • The surviving parent(s); or
  • The personal representative of the deceased’s estate.

Note: If a surviving family member, such as a child, does not initiate the lawsuit within three months, anyone is allowed to do it.

How to Prove Wrongful Death

During a wrongful death claim, the plaintiff (the surviving family member or personal representative of the decedent’s estate) has the opportunity to recover compensation when the negligent, reckless, or careless acts of a defendant or via a defendant’s product or service led to a fatal accident.

To prove that a defendant negligently caused a wrongful death, the plaintiff and their attorney must show the following four elements:

  1. The defendant owed a duty of care to prevent the harm that led to the decedent’s death. This means that the law requires the defendant to submit to a standard of normal, careful, and safe behavior.
  2. These defendants somehow “broke” or failed to comply with this duty of care. You must prove that a reasonable entity or person in the same position would have submitted to that particular duty of care.
  3. If the defendant wasn’t careless, the victim or decedent would still be alive or not rendered incapacitated. You must show how the decedent died.
  4. As the surviving family members of the decedent or the decedent’s estate, you suffered damages only rectified by financial compensation. Importance of Time When Filing a Wrongful Death Claim

Texas gives you only a fraction of the time to formally object to a specific person or entity’s behavior when a person loses their life due to their illegal, thoughtless, or intentional act. While it is essential to conduct your due diligence, create a strategic plan, and remain up-to-date on all statutes of limitations while seeking legal help, you need to begin the claims process as soon as possible.

The statute of limitations on pursuing a wrongful death claim in Texas is two years (like most other personal injury claims). If you do not file a lawsuit in a Texas civil court within two years from the date of your loved one’s passing, it is highly likely that you will be barred from recovering compensation.
